- What does debt conversion inducement expense mean?
- Captures the non-cash expense incurred when a company offers additional consideration to induce holders of convertible debt to convert their holdings into equity before the scheduled maturity. This metric highlights the cost of accelerating debt reduction and managing the capital structure. It is essential for understanding the impact of debt-to-equity conversions on earnings.
